Expanding Services to Meet Growing Needs


As Land of Belief grows, so does its mission. The sanctuary is expanding its services to better support families and animals facing unique challenges. These expansions include:


  • Family Support: Offering resources and advocacy to help families navigate complex situations with greater ease.

  • Sensory-Aware Environments: Creating spaces where children with sensory sensitivities can feel calm and safe.

  • Animal Care: Providing comfort and care for animals who have been overlooked or misunderstood, giving them a chance to heal and thrive.


Each new service is a step toward building a more inclusive and compassionate community. These efforts help lift burdens and create a gentler world for everyone involved.

The Vision for a Main Building and Future Growth


One of the most exciting goals for Land of Belief is the construction of a main building. This space will allow the sanctuary to serve more people and animals, expanding its reach and impact. The building will include:


  • Dedicated areas for sensory-friendly activities.

  • Spaces for family support and advocacy services.

  • Comfortable accommodations for animals needing care.

  • Community gathering spaces to foster connection and healing.


This vision reflects a commitment to growth rooted in compassion and understanding.
